Subject: [PATCH] [4.2.x] Fixed CVE-2026-33034 -- Enforced
 DATA_UPLOAD_MAX_MEMORY_SIZE on body size in ASGI requests.

The `body` property in `HttpRequest` checks DATA_UPLOAD_MAX_MEMORY_SIZE
against the declared `Content-Length` header before reading. On the ASGI
path, chunked requests carry no `Content-Length`, so the check evaluated
to 0 and always passed regardless of the actual body size.

This work adds a new check on the actual number of bytes consumed.

Thanks to Superior for the report, and to Jake Howard and Jacob Walls
for reviews.

Backport of 953c238058c0ce387a1a41cb491bfc1875d73ad0 from main.

diff --git a/django/http/request.py b/django/http/request.py
index 4d1d077ec19d..0b86444c4bc7 100644
--- a/django/http/request.py
+++ b/django/http/request.py
@@ -1,5 +1,6 @@
 import codecs
 import copy
+import os
 from io import BytesIO
 from itertools import chain
 from urllib.parse import parse_qsl, quote, urlencode, urljoin, urlsplit
@@ -328,25 +329,49 @@ def body(self):
                     "You cannot access body after reading from request's data stream"
                 )
 
-            # Limit the maximum request data size that will be handled in-memory.
-            if (
-                settings.DATA_UPLOAD_MAX_MEMORY_SIZE is not None
-                and int(self.META.get("CONTENT_LENGTH") or 0)
-                > settings.DATA_UPLOAD_MAX_MEMORY_SIZE
-            ):
-                raise RequestDataTooBig(
-                    "Request body exceeded settings.DATA_UPLOAD_MAX_MEMORY_SIZE."
-                )
+            # Limit the maximum request data size that will be handled
+            # in-memory. Reject early when Content-Length is present and
+            # already exceeds the limit, avoiding reading the body at all.
+            self._check_data_too_big(int(self.META.get("CONTENT_LENGTH") or 0))
+
+            # Content-Length can be absent or understated (e.g.
+            # `Transfer-Encoding: chunked` on ASGI), so for seekable
+            # streams (e.g. SpooledTemporaryFile on ASGI), check the actual
+            # buffered size before reading it all into memory.
+            if hasattr(self._stream, "seekable") and self._stream.seekable():
+                stream_size = self._stream.seek(0, os.SEEK_END)
+                self._check_data_too_big(stream_size)
+                self._stream.seek(0)
+                did_check = True
+            else:
+                did_check = False
 
             try:
-                self._body = self.read()
+                if settings.DATA_UPLOAD_MAX_MEMORY_SIZE is not None and not did_check:
+                    # Read one byte past the limit to detect an oversize body
+                    # without loading it all into memory first.
+                    self._body = self.read(settings.DATA_UPLOAD_MAX_MEMORY_SIZE + 1)
+                else:
+                    self._body = self.read()
             except OSError as e:
                 raise UnreadablePostError(*e.args) from e
             finally:
                 self._stream.close()
             self._stream = BytesIO(self._body)
+            if not did_check:
+                stream_size = self._stream.seek(0, os.SEEK_END)
+                self._check_data_too_big(stream_size)
+                self._stream.seek(0)
         return self._body
 
+    def _check_data_too_big(self, length):
+        if (
+            settings.DATA_UPLOAD_MAX_MEMORY_SIZE is not None
+            and length > settings.DATA_UPLOAD_MAX_MEMORY_SIZE
+        ):
+            msg = "Request body exceeded settings.DATA_UPLOAD_MAX_MEMORY_SIZE."
+            raise RequestDataTooBig(msg)
+
     def _mark_post_parse_error(self):
         self._post = QueryDict()
         self._files = MultiValueDict()
